CSS/HTML命名规范与优化策略:页面SEO提升关键

0 下载量 116 浏览量 更新于2024-09-01 收藏 224KB PDF 举报
本文档是一份关于CSS与XHTML书写规范以及常见问题的总结,针对页面最优化进行了详细的讲解。这份资料是在去年为公司培训时编写的,旨在提升团队在开发过程中遵循的最佳实践。作者邀请读者提供反馈,以不断完善这份白皮书。 文档首先关注于div+CSS的命名规范,强调了命名的一致性和易读性。CSS的ID命名应遵循一定的规则,如: 1.1. div+css命名规范: - 页面结构元素如页头(header)、登录条(loginBar)、标志(logo)等都给出了明确的命名建议,便于理解和维护。 - 导航部分有主导航(mainNav)、子导航(subNav)、菜单(menu)等,清晰地划分了层次关系。 - 内容区域定义为content,有助于搜索引擎识别和优化。 1.2. CSS的ID命名规范: - 对页面关键部分进行命名,如外套(wrapper)、主导航(mainNav)、页脚<footer)等,确保标识独特且有意义。 - 使用如globalNav、topnav等特定词汇来区分不同的导航位置。 文档接下来讨论了XHTML编码的基本规范,包括正确使用标签、属性和结构,以确保网页的正确解析和可访问性。 推荐的网页制作规范部分涵盖了如何编写符合语义化的HTML,以及如何通过良好的代码结构和优化技巧来提升性能。例如,CSS常用优化技巧可能涉及选择器优先级、避免使用!important、压缩CSS等。 浏览器兼容性问题总结是必不可少的,因为不同浏览器可能对某些CSS和JavaScript特性有不同的支持。通过理解这些差异,开发者可以实现跨浏览器的兼容性。 最后,文档探讨了XHTML标准的DIV+CSS布局对网站SEO的影响,指出良好命名和结构对搜索引擎排名的重要性。通过遵循这些规范,网站的搜索引擎友好度能得到显著提高。 这份文档提供了丰富的CSS和XHTML书写规范,旨在帮助开发者创建出高效、可维护且SEO友好的网页,同时兼顾了浏览器兼容性和用户体验。通过学习和实践这些规范,开发者能提升自己的技能,优化网页性能,确保项目的顺利进行。